Michael Hollins is a leadership coach, author, and athletics administrator at Kent State University, focusing on student-athlete success and leadership. A former college football All-American, he leverages his experience to coach individuals on navigating transitions and achieving peak performance. He holds a Master of Arts from John Carroll University and a Weatherhead Coaching Certificate.
